Transaction 9144ac49181ec78a5ca7d351c3a41909c24fe0ee35b8e653739609ce44a52aab

1 Input
2 Outputs
  • 9144ac49181ec78a5ca7d351c3a41909c24fe0ee35b8e653739609ce44a52aab:0
  • value  132722
    address  138AYyhQPozzj3uurEHdJY7JraCsCv19wK
  • 9144ac49181ec78a5ca7d351c3a41909c24fe0ee35b8e653739609ce44a52aab:1
  • value  1074926932
    address  3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h